John Benci III Obituary

John Benci III was a great guy who loved everyone he met.  On February 15, 2021 John lost his courageous battle with cancer.  He was 46 years old.  John was born in Cleveland, Ohio on April 30, 1974.  He is the son of Nellie (nee Robuck) and John Benci II.      

John enjoyed life.  He loved his family and friends, they were his first priority.  John enjoyed working on model cars, hunting and fishing with Kory. He loved family vacations, especially going to Myrtle Beach and on Caribbean cruises. 

John loved New London and served on the New London Recreation Park Board for 8 years.  He worked at Johnston Supply in Ashland, Ohio for the past 6 years and Sirna and Son for 3 years, where co-workers became close friends and extended family. 

He is survived by his beautiful and loving wife of 13 years, Lana Benci of New London, Ohio; two sons: Kory Benci (Maci Mayhorn) of New London and Anthony Kitson (Jackie Shuler) of Medina; his mother Nellie Benci and his brother, Ed Benci.  His in-laws: Emory and Jennifer Bateson, Elizabeth (Michael) Zellner, Amanda Bateson, Park (Alicia) Bateson; niece Sophia, nephews Milo and Xavier and his grandpup Jasmine.

John was preceded in death by his father John Benci II on November 3, 2015 and his maternal grandparents, John and Emma Robuck.
